The wellness room on Level 2 of the Orlington building may be booked by visitors only when accompanied by a staff sponsor. Bookings run in 30-minute blocks through the facilities desk diary, with a maximum of two blocks per day per visitor. The room must be left tidy, lights off, and the door closed on exit. Facilities staff should confirm the sponsor's name before unlocking. The door operates on a keypad rather than badge readers, and staff should use the code below.

door code, tagef-bajop: bdg-SB-7

Hi Tomas — handing over the Ledgerline dedup run. The nightly job merged roughly 4,200 duplicate customer records; 37 ambiguous pairs were flagged for manual review and parked in the holding queue. Support may see merged histories tomorrow; the runbook covers how to explain this. For any disputed merges, escalate to the data steward at this address.

escalation mailbox, yafog-kafof: eliok@xolmarcloud.local

## Large-Deal Discount Policy (Managers Only)

For deals above the Tier 3 threshold, Veldane Systems permits discounts up to 18% with regional approval; anything beyond requires sign-off from the commercial director. Exceptions logged this quarter relate mainly to the Orvass retail accounts. As incoming director, note that this policy is under review ahead of next year's pricing strategy, summarised below.

board note of yajog-bahop: The steering committee signed off on a budget of $236.5 million for Project Raleth.

**Handover: Dispatchly assignment heuristic**

Handing the driver-assignment heuristic work to Priya before the sprint close. The proximity-weighted scorer is live in staging; fairness rebalancing is still behind a flag. Known issue: ties resolve nondeterministically under load. Everything she needs is in the staging config, which currently reads as follows.

deployment values, yadug-bawif:
[framir]
team = pelox
access_code = ac_a38ab2
owner = tamion.julael
host = framir.tolvaqlabs.test
port = 11211
peer = tammir.zemvargrid.local
salt = 2215ef03
pin = 1541